At the heart of the conventional mental map is the assumption of knowing. An expert solves a technical problem by applying knowledge. At the heart of the positive mental map is the assumption of collective learning.
Operating from the self-interested assumptions of the conventional map, one survives by competing for limited resources. Life is a game and you win by being clever, not by embracing a higher purpose, living with integrity, serving the common good, and co-creating the emerging future.

In a positive organization people bring their discretionary energy to work because their work matters and they feel they are a part of something bigger than self.
In the process of development, some people become bilingual and acquire the capacity to effectively invite others to create more positive organizational cultures. One goal of Positive Organization is to accelerate the developmental process. The book is designed to help the reader discover the positive mental map without a major life crisis.
The positive mental map invites each of us to see the world in a way that will allow us to help others to flourish and exceed expectations.
